I've had two replacement Kindles and both were refurbished. I know that because they told me. I couldn't have told it from the Kindle. They were identical to the new ones.
I've also bought a couple of refurbished Kindles. They don't give much off on them. I think one was $20 cheaper and the other one was during a sale so it was a little cheaper than that. Both came with 1 year warranties just like the new ones.
I think for Kindles "refurbished" means something a little different than it does for other things.
